ALSO:

• Dupuis gets 3 years, 1.4 mil per. Half-Season Eaton gets 2 years, 1 mil per which is an absolute steal if he goes even one of them without serious injury OR if he goes half a season without he’s mouth watering trade bait. Shero gets a Spicy Chicken sandwich from Wendy’s for 5 min, .45 per. It was originally asking for $5 deal, declined an offer from Kevin Lowe for $35 million and a faberge egg.

• Hitting the dusty trail is Conklin who will learn to do The Flop alongside Chris Osgood in Detroit for $770,000. Call me nuts but I figured he could at LEAST get a mil. Maybe he takes the discount to possibly start on ballin’ team.

• Eddy Spaghetti gains a few more reasons to make the trip to Tampa next season as Malone, Roberts and Adam Hall all join Michel Oullet with Barry Melrose’s new operation.

• Oh. And Malkin agrees in principal to Sid Contract Lite. 5 yrs, 8.7 mil per. Doesn’t count against cap until next season. If you doubt how important Crosby signing that deal after an MVP season is, you should probably stop breathing.
